Refrigerated truck companies are vital in the logistics and transportation sector, specializing in the manufacturing of vehicles with temperature-controlled compartments. These companies ensure the safe and efficient transport of perishable goods, including food and pharmaceuticals. Their expertise supports industries reliant on the reliable and temperature-regulated delivery of sensitive cargo.

Competitive Landscape:


The market features a mix of established giants and regional players, with diverse strengths and specializations. Prominent players include:




  • Daimler Truck AG (Germany): A global leader, offering a wide range of refrigerated truck models under the Mercedes-Benz and FUSO brands.


  • Thermo King (US): A major player specializing in refrigerated trailer and truck units, known for its innovative and reliable solutions.


  • Carrier Transicold (US): Another leading player known for its diverse product portfolio and strong presence in North America.


  • Scania AB (Sweden): A European leader renowned for its fuel-efficient and sustainable refrigerated trucks.


  • Dongfeng Motor Corporation (China): A prominent player in Asia, offering cost-effective refrigerated trucks tailored to the local market.


Strategies for Market Share:


To thrive in this competitive environment, players adopt diverse strategies:




  • Product Innovation: Focusing on developing refrigerated trucks with enhanced features like improved insulation, fuel efficiency, temperature control systems, and telematics solutions.


  • Sustainability Focus: Investing in electric and hybrid refrigerated trucks, as well as lightweight materials and eco-friendly refrigerants, to comply with regulations and meet customer demands.


  • Geographic Expansion: Entering high-growth regions like Asia-Pacific and Latin America, establishing local production facilities and distribution networks.


  • Vertical Integration: Gaining control over the supply chain, from components like engines and refrigerating units to finished trucks, to ensure quality and optimize costs.


  • Partnerships and Acquisitions: Collaborating with technology companies, logistics providers, and research institutions to access new technologies and expand service offerings.


Market Share Factors:


Several factors influence a player's market share:




  • Product Portfolio: Offering a diversified range of refrigerated trucks catering to different payload capacities, temperature requirements, and operating environments strengthens brand preference.


  • Technical Expertise: Having robust R&D and engineering capabilities to develop reliable and efficient refrigerated trucks is crucial.


  • After-sales Service: Providing comprehensive after-sales support, including maintenance, repair, and spare parts availability, attracts and retains customers.


  • Compliance with Regulations: Adherence to stringent safety and emission regulations, like Euro VI in Europe and EPA standards in the US, is essential for market access.


  • Cost-effectiveness: Balancing performance with competitive pricing, especially in price-sensitive regions, is vital for gaining market share.

Recent Developments :




  • August 2023: Daimler Truck unveiled a new line of electric refrigerated trucks with extended range and faster charging capabilities.


  • October 2023: Thermo King introduced a smart trailer connected to an AI-powered platform, optimizing temperature control and fuel efficiency.


  • November 2023: Carrier Transicold partnered with a leading telematics provider to offer real-time tracking and remote monitoring solutions for refrigerated trucks.


  • December 2023: The European Union proposed tougher emission standards for trucks, driving further developments in electric and hybrid refrigerated truck technologies.
